Vue项目开发需要准备和配置些什么环境?一、首先需要安装node.js 下载:安装node.js链接 安装在D盘 window+R,输入cmd,打开命令提示符窗口,输入:npm -v检测是否安装成功,如果输出版本号,则表示安装成功,如图:npm包管理工具(package manager)自动安装完成二、改变原有的环境变量1、首先配置npm的全局模块的存放路径、cache的路径,此处我选择放在:D:
首先我们先了解为什么要使用webpack???        Webpack 是一个开源的前端打包工具。Webpack 提供了前端开发缺乏的模块化开发方式,将各种静态资源视为模块,并从它生成优化过的代码。 Webpack 可以从终端、或是更改 webpack.config.js 来设置各项功能。 要使用 Webpack 前须先安装Node
转载 10月前
43阅读
近日,有开发者在知乎上提出了一个问题:“TypeScript 不适合在 vue 业务开发中使用?”,Vue的作者尤雨溪针对这一问题发表了自己的看法,也解释了Vue 3.0选用TypeScript的原因,全文如下。注:本文已获得尤雨溪本人授权转载。必须要承认的是,2.x 的 TS 支持显然跟 React 和 Angular 是有差距的,这也是为什么 3.0 要加强这一块。关于目前 2.x 跟 TS
事件监听    在开发中,需要监听用户发生的事件,如点击、拖拽、键盘操作等,在Vue中,使用v-on指令绑定事件监听器。v-on的语法糖为:@v-on基本操作    在下面代码中,使用了v-on语法(使用的是语法糖@)绑定了一个点击事件,事件指向了一个methods中定义的函数:<div id="app"&
# 在 Vue 2 项目中引入 Axios 进行 HTTP 请求的完整指南 在现代的前端开发中,处理 HTTP 请求是一个不可或缺的部分。为了与后端服务器进行数据交互,`Axios` 是一个非常流行的库,具有良好的功能和简单的API。本文将详细介绍如何在 Vue 2 项目中引入 Axios,并通过示例展示其基本用法。 ## 什么是 Axios? Axios 是一个基于 Promise 的 H
原创 2024-08-07 07:41:05
202阅读
在 Vite创建Vue3项目 中讲到,Vite 官方对 Vue 的支持只针对于Vue3.x 版本,而对于 Vue2.x 是不支持的。今天
原创 2022-07-20 06:39:55
2411阅读
# Vue2项目封装Axios的完整指南 在现代前端开发中,Axios作为一个流行的HTTP客户端库,常用于与API进行交互和数据请求。在Vue2项目中封装Axios是一个提升代码可复用性和可维护性的好方法。本文将为你详细讲解如何在Vue2项目中封装Axios。 ## 流程概述 以下是封装Axios的步骤: | 步骤 | 描述 | |
原创 10月前
244阅读
在本篇博文中,我将介绍如何在一个 Vue 2 项目中安装并配置 TypeScript。这个过程将从环境准备开始,分步指导到配置详解、验证测试、优化技巧和排错指南,确保读者能够全面掌握这一过程。 ### 环境准备 在开始之前,我们需要确保开发环境满足以下前置依赖的要求: 1. **Node.js**:确保安装了 Node.js (建议版本 10.x 以上) 2. **Vue CLI**:确保安
原创 5月前
49阅读
ESLint结合Webpack使用一、安装二、后续配置 一、安装webpack集成ESLint并不是以插件的方式来完成的,而是通过loader机制。yarn add eslint eslint-loader --dev初始化eslint配置文件yarn eslint --init配置webpack.config.js中的rules{ test: /\.js$/,
Vue的概述渐进式JavaScript框架前端三大框架(React,Vue,Angular) vue (读音 /vjuː/,类似于 view) 是一套用于构建用户界面的渐进式框架。简单,高效,生态丰富(插件多)Vue的安装与使用安装1.直接引用CDN<script src="https://cdn.jsdelivr.net/npm/vue@2.6.14/dist/vue.js">&lt
项目完成之后,当然不能满足于在我们的开发环境下跑一跑。我们可以打包发布到服务器上,让大家一起来欣赏一下你的作品。那么 vue 项目如何打包发布呢,新建的项目目录下通常都有一个 README.md 的文件,里面就描述了发布的步骤:下面这个是 vue-cli 3.x 创建的项目中的 README.md 文件内容:# firstpage ## Project setupnpm install### C
创建VUE项目vue-cli2.0版本和3.0版本的区别,将vue2.0项目升级为vue3.0项目使用vue-cli2.0版本创建vue项目创建前的准备开始创建创建过程项目正常创建使用vue-cli3.0版本创建vue项目安装vue-cli脚手架失败将vue2.0版本升级为vue3.0版本Vue2Vue3使用层面上的区别总结Vue 3 的 Template 支持多个根标签,Vue 2 不支持
现实背景:很多时候我们会在全局调用一些方法。  实现方式两种:官网的实现use方法,然后你也可以用野路子直接在Vue.prototype上面定义。  先说野路子,因为其实野路子就是最根本的实现方式,官方的use实现也是一样的,只是use很好的封装了。 /* *main.js中实例Vue时添加方法 */ import Vue from 'vue'; //这样以后你就可以在该项目下的其他组件中使
接上篇文章(过去了太久了,唉),在搭建好了新的Vue的框架并成功运行起来后,开始进行相关的配置和项目开发。配置之前,需要将官网教程看完:Vue Cli3教程;相关配置参数。一、根据官网教程,一些需要手动的配置,要自己建一个名为vue.config.js的文件来覆盖默认配置,这个配置文件网上都有的,这里列出我自己的配置文件:/** * vue.config.js * vue.config.js
推荐开源项目:vuepress-theme-api - 为API文档打造的理想主题 vuepress-theme-api??? A api-friendly theme for VuePress.项目地址:https://gitcode.com/gh_mirrors/vu/vuepress-theme-api 在技术文档的世界中,拥有一个既美观又功能强大的主题是非常重要的。今天,我想要向大家推荐一
nodejs // 检查版本:node -vnpm 淘宝镜像 是个仓库 放的都是nodejs的插件vue-cli // 检查版本:vue -Vgit // 检查版本:git version1.首先需要安装nodenode是基石 后来才有了 angela(谷歌的)   react(facebook的)   vue   webpack cli vue 等等一切 为什
一.JS有几种方法判断变量类型简单的四种1.typy of 常用于基本数据类型 用法:type of "John"2.instance of 判断对象是否是指定的类型(常用于引用数据),数据判断正确返回TRUE,判断不正确返回FALSE,用法 [ ] instance of array3.Constructor(用于应用数据类型) :获取实例的构造函数判断和某个类是否相同,不会把原型链的其他类带进
今年年初,尤大大公布了一个重磅消息,将Vue3作为Vue的默认版本。这无疑不是对我们开发人员的内卷煽风点火!vue默认版本改动意味着,官方将会把Vue研发重心放到vue3上,vue2也开始走下坡路,至于淘汰过时只是时间问题了。从而周边生态、组件、插件等都会以vue3为默认版本重点关注,vue2中的组件插件库将会慢慢得不到维护与迭代更新,因此,我们不得不跟上时代的步伐,转战vue3 ~接下来手把手带
转载 2023-11-09 22:37:14
80阅读
更新 vue2 项目中的 jQuery 版本是一个需要仔细考虑的过程。众所周知,jQuery 是一个强大的 JavaScript 库,但它的使用在现代前端开发中逐渐减少,尤其是在许多项目采用 Vue.js 等框架时。因此,在升级过程中,需要注意兼容性问题、性能优化以及潜在的技术债务。 ### 业务场景分析 在我们的方法论中,项目的需求驱动了 jQuery 版本的升级。我们的用户希望能在现有的 V
原创 6月前
82阅读
梁晓莹:  微医前端技术部 一只喜欢读书????&&游泳????????的猪猪女孩~????当前版本 vite@2.3.7一. 适合什么项目迁移使用 vue2 的系统内部系统 - 无需大型流量场景:因为 vite 更迭较快,导致系统需要定期改动基础功能,造成不稳定非 ssr 系统 - ssr 还有很多问题,暂且等社区丰富起来定期有人维护的系统对开发有痛点而想要改进:比
  • 1
  • 2
  • 3
  • 4
  • 5